On 05/30/2016 11:33 AM, Vinod Koul wrote:
> On Fri, May 27, 2016 at 09:23:12PM +0100, Mark Brown wrote:
>> On Fri, May 27, 2016 at 06:45:41PM +0800, Chris Zhong wrote:
>>> codec driver get some interfaces from cdn-dp driver, than using those
>>> to set DP audio formats, corresponding to alsa formats.
>> I'm not seeing anything Rockchip specific in here...  DisplayPort is
>> backwards compatible with HDMI, shouldn't this be using the existing
>> hdmi-codec code?
>
> Yup, typically only difference between the two would be programming the
> info frame for DP or HDMI, otherwise it is pretty much same stuff...
>
> They should patch hdmi-codec for that, if that is not supported.
